Junker Queen is the 34th hero of Overwatch and the first new tank announced for Overwatch 2.

One of the main focuses of today’s Overwatch 2 revelation event was a deep dive into the new hero Junker Queen. It’s an “aggressive tank,” lead hero designer Geoff Goodman said during the broadcast. “We didn’t want her to be a Reinhardt style, to be left behind and save her team. She has this very fierce nature and we wanted her to be represented in the game as well.”
Junker Queen has an ax that can spin around Reinhardt’s hammer. A key difference is that it is a skill in a reuse time: it is called Carnage. He has a shotgun as his main fire.
Junker Queen’s ax is called Carnage.

His melee attack is with a knife called a Jagged Blade. Junker Queen is referred to as Gracie: she has nicknames for each of her weapons. It does a little more damage than other characters’ melee attacks and wounds the enemy, Goodman said.

You can also throw the blade as a secondary fire at a reuse time. If you connect with an enemy, you can shoot him.
With his Scream Commander, he can increase the speed and excessive health of the heroes around him. Some of his skills drain HP from enemy heroes and restore some of his own health (i.e. the wound effect). Based on the video of the Reveal event, Junked Queen’s health is 425 without any basic junk.

Junker Queen’s Ultimate is called Rampage. He gathers his weapons in what Goodman calls “a kind of magnetized metal vortex.” She will advance and any enemy she connects with will be wounded. This creates an anti-healing disadvantage for enemies: they will not be able to heal for a limited time.
Art director Dion Rogers said Junker Queen emerged from the Junkertown map, which was added to the original game in 2017. “We started creating this map that was associated with Roadhog and Junkrat,” Rogers said. “This story began to appear where they had been expelled from the city and so we said, ‘Who expelled them?’ And we said, “Well, maybe there’s some kind of leader.” Eventually, the team realized that it was Junker Queen.
However, she was not always the queen of Junkertown (her real name is Odessa “Dez” Stone). In the animated short released at the end of the Reveal event, we see her fight a Junker King. Rogers noted that Junker Queen was specifically designed as a solo tank for a 5v5 format. All of the above tanks were created for the original game’s 6v6 configuration, so their skills were built with the knowledge that it would be a solo tank.
Meanwhile, Junker Queen’s sound design aligns with her punk aesthetic. You will hear the strings of the guitar as you pull out the ax, for example. You can also expect to hear new voice lines from her through the Junkertown PA system. He has the voice of actor Leah de Niese.

Undoubtedly, Junker Queen seems to fit in with the ethos of Overwatch 2 of making tanks much more fighting and getting to the heart of the action, rather than staying behind a barrier. Her skills make her look like she will be perfect for fast competitions.
It’s easy to draw parallels between the Junker Queen kit and the skills of other heroes. The secondary fire with the knife has similarities to Roadhog’s chain hook, can increase the speed of your team like Lucius, and can invoke the anti-healing effects of Ana’s biotic grenade. “When we’re creating new heroes, it’s important to us that heroes feel unique, even if they use tools similar to other heroes,” Goodman said in an interview this week. “He’s kind of unique because he’s the first hero since Lucius to speed up his team and the first hero since Ana to provide an anti-healing effect. So in a lot of ways, he’s great for opening up more options for your team and how it is played, where if you really want to increase your speed, you now have two options.
“We want to make sure that when you grab the ax and you want to play Junker Queen, you really feel the style of play that it would have, that aggressive style of play. So its ability to give you a boost and get closer. […] it almost has that aura of fear around it because it’s really deadly in that range, “Goodman added.

Junker Queen will be playing for the first time in the second PVP beta of Overwatch 2, which will begin on June 28th. You can find out how to access the beta version here. Overwatch 2 will be released on October 4th.
